The Nevada State Athletic Commission released this Monday the salaries paid to fighters who participated in UFC-86, held last Saturday in Las Vegas. The biggest purse went to Forrest griffin who earned 250 thousand dollars to beat the light heavyweight champion, Quinton jackson, in the judges' decision. Rampage, who lost the belt, pocketed $225 in purse money. Check out the full list below:
Forrest griffin: $250,000 (including $150,000 win bonus) won
Quinton jackson: $ 225,000
Patrick Cote: $32,000 ($16,000 win bonus) won
Ricardo Almeida: $23,000
Joe Stevenson: $60,000 ($30,000 win bonus) won
Gleison Tibau: $11,000
Josh koscheck: $70,000 ($35,000 win bonus) won
Chris Lytle: $14,000
Tyson Griffin: $40,000 ($20,000 win bonus) won
Marcus Aurelio: $40,000
Gabriel Gonzaga: $100,000 ($50,000 win bonus) won
Justin McCully: $5,000
Cole Miller: $20,000 ($10,000 win bonus) won
Jorge Gurgel: $10,000
Melvin Guillard: $20,000 ($10,000 win bonus) won
Dennis Siver: $7,000
Justin Buchholz: $8,000 ($4000 win bonus) won
Corey Hill: $8,000
